Many people in our community have expressed an interest in learning about encaustic painting -- painting with molten beeswax and pigments. If you have seen my 3 foot x 7 foot artwork called "Art, Music, Literature -- A Boquete Tapestry" on the ground floor of our new Boquete Library, then you have seen the myriad ways encaustic can be presented.

And now you have the opportunity to learn it for yourself! I have scheduled Two Beginning Workshops and Two Intermediate Workshops:

BEGINNING WORKSHOP: (Single-Day)
Students of all abilities and levels are invited to learn about encaustic painting in history and its contemporary processes. 

Topics covered include: 
  •  selecting appropriate grounds
  •  encaustic medium preparation
  •  mixing wax medium and pigments
  •  fusing tools and fusing layers
  •  using techniques such as embedding, accretion, intaglio and others. 

Throughout the day we will discuss resources for setting up and maintaining a home encaustic workshop. The four hours are intensive, but highly enjoyable. Students will leave the hands-on workshop with their own 10" x 10" encaustic painting and a solid foundation with which to further explore this unique medium. In addition, you will have learned how to handle supplies and will be exposed to a number of tools and techniques. You will have become proficient and confident in handling these artist materials and you will develop your creativity as it relates to this medium. INTERMEDIATE WORKSHOP: (Single-Day)
Students who have taken my Beginning Workshop this year or last year will want to enroll in this workshop. A brief recap of what was covered in the Beginning Workshop leads right into exposure to the following:
  •  fusing with irons
  •  creating grooves with carving tools
  •  image transfers
  •  shellac burn -- light your art on fire!!
